Common Prompt Engineering Mistakes (And How to Fix Them)

Prompt engineering is a powerful way to guide generative AI models, but many users, especially beginners, struggle with common Prompt Engineering Mistakes that weaken results. Vague instructions, missing context, or unstructured outputs often lead to inaccurate or irrelevant responses. This article highlights the most frequent Prompt Engineering Mistakes, explains their real-world impact, and provides actionable fixes to help you write better prompts. By avoiding these errors, you can save time, improve reliability, and unlock the full value of AI-driven workflows.

Why Beginners Struggle With Prompt Engineering

Beginners often find prompt engineering challenging because the process demands both clarity of thought and technical precision. Unlike casual instructions, effective prompts must balance context, constraints, and role assignment to guide the model toward accurate outputs. Many first-time users treat AI systems as open-ended assistants, expecting them to “figure it out,” which results in vague or incomplete responses. Without understanding how models interpret input, beginners quickly get frustrated by inconsistent results. Recognizing these common struggles is the first step toward building better prompt-writing habits.

Most Common Prompting Mistakes

While prompt engineering seems simple at first, certain mistakes repeatedly appear among new and even experienced users. These errors reduce accuracy, waste time, and prevent AI from delivering the best results. Below are the most common pitfalls and why they matter.

Vague Instructions

Unclear prompts like “write about marketing” leave too much room for interpretation, producing generic or irrelevant content. AI models require explicit goals to perform well. For example:

"Write a 300-word blog post for small business owners on how email marketing improves customer retention."

Missing Context & Role Definition

Without role or context cues, models often return outputs that miss the intended audience. A better approach is to assign a role or perspective in the prompt, such as:

"Act as a financial advisor and explain three investment strategies for beginners with less than $1,000 to invest."

Ignoring Output Formatting

When users don’t specify structure, outputs often come back unorganized. Asking for lists, tables, or specific formats improves usability. For instance:

"Provide five LinkedIn post ideas in a bullet list format with 15–20 words each."

Keyword-Stuffing & Length Issues

Beginners sometimes overload prompts with repeated keywords or long, unfocused instructions. This confuses the model and reduces quality. A concise prompt works better:

"Summarize the top 3 benefits of electric bikes for urban commuters in 100 words."

Limited Testing

Testing only one or two prompts leads to inconsistent results. Iteration is essential to refine AI behavior. A good habit is to try several variations:

"Write a product description for a smart thermostat in three tones: professional, casual, and humorous."

Real-World Impact of Bad Prompts

Poorly designed prompts don’t just affect the quality of AI outputs, they create ripple effects that impact productivity, decision-making, and customer experiences. When instructions are vague or misaligned, models can generate irrelevant, misleading, or incomplete responses. This wastes time in editing, increases operational costs, and can even harm business credibility if inaccurate content is published or shared with customers.

Poorly designed prompts often fail in real-world applications. To see how good prompting drives value, explore our guide on Prompt Engineering Use Cases.

How LLMs Treat Poor Inputs

Large language models follow the instructions they receive, even if those instructions are flawed. Without clear scope or structure, the model often defaults to generic responses or fills gaps with assumptions. For example:

"Explain marketing."

This prompt produces a broad answer, whereas specifying “Explain three key digital marketing strategies for startups with limited budgets” generates a much more actionable result.

Consequences for Businesses

When prompts are inconsistent, businesses face challenges such as off-brand messaging, longer production cycles, and increased reliance on manual review. In industries like healthcare, finance, or legal services, bad prompts can even introduce compliance risks. On a practical level, poor prompt design reduces return on investment by negating the efficiency that generative AI is supposed to bring.

Best Practices for Overcoming Mistakes

Avoiding common prompt engineering errors requires clarity, structure, and testing. By applying simple best practices, users can transform vague or inefficient prompts into precise instructions that guide AI toward better results. The following approaches directly address the mistakes highlighted earlier.

For a complete overview of advanced techniques and career insights, read our full guide on Prompt Engineering for Generative AI.

Clarity & Conciseness

Keep prompts short, specific, and free of unnecessary filler. Direct instructions help the model focus on the core task without confusion. For example:

"Write a 150-word introduction explaining the benefits of remote work for small businesses."

Adding Role & Context

Assigning a role gives the AI a perspective to adopt, while context ensures relevance. This combination produces more tailored outputs. For instance:

"Act as a career coach and provide three practical tips for recent graduates entering the job market."

Structuring Outputs with Constraints

Define clear formatting and constraints to make outputs easier to use. This could mean requesting bullet points, limiting word count, or specifying tone. Example:

"List five social media post ideas for an eco-friendly brand, each under 20 words, in bullet format."

Iterative Testing for Reliability

Prompt engineering is an iterative process. Testing multiple variations and refining instructions over time ensures consistency. A good testing prompt might be:

"Generate three alternative headlines for an article on AI in education, each under 12 words."

Conclusion: Building Confidence as a Prompt Engineer

Prompt engineering mistakes are part of the learning process, but with clarity, structure, and iterative testing, anyone can improve their results. By recognizing common errors such as vague instructions, missing context, or lack of formatting and applying best practices, users quickly build confidence in their ability to guide AI effectively.

Once you learn how to avoid common mistakes, the next step is building a career in the field. Our article on Prompt Engineering Career Path covers essential skills, roles, and salary expectations for 2025.

Prompt engineering is just one building block of the broader AI landscape. See the full picture in our root guide: Generative AI: Overview, Models, Applications, Challenges & Future.

Over time, this confidence translates into more reliable outputs, stronger business value, and greater trust in generative AI systems. Mastery doesn’t come from avoiding mistakes entirely, but from learning how to fix them and refining your approach with every prompt.

Frequently Asked Questions

What are the most common prompt engineering mistakes?

Common mistakes include vague instructions, missing context or role definition, ignoring output formatting, keyword stuffing, and limited testing of prompts.

Why do beginners struggle with prompt engineering?

Beginners often struggle because they underestimate the importance of clarity, context, and iterative testing. Without these, AI systems misinterpret prompts and generate poor outputs.

How do bad prompts affect AI performance?

Poorly designed prompts can cause irrelevant, biased, or low-quality AI outputs. This reduces reliability for businesses and wastes resources.

How can I fix prompt engineering mistakes?

Use clarity and concise language, define roles and context, set structured outputs with constraints, and test iteratively to refine reliability.

What are best practices for prompt engineering?

Best practices include writing clear instructions, adding context, structuring expected outputs, testing prompts in multiple scenarios, and learning from failed attempts.


Want to try the latest AI models without a monthly subscription? PanelsAI gives you access to GPT-4o, Claude, Gemini, and more — pay only for what you use, starting at $1 →